Technical Considerations and Usage Limitations
While this asset pack is robust, experienced sellers know where to exercise caution. Not every design in a 100-piece bundle will be suitable for every application. I advise testing specific files before listing them for intricate Cricut project work. Some script fonts may have thin connecting lines that could tear during weeding if cut too small. Similarly, when using these for tiny sticker design or planner icons, ensure the text remains legible at reduced scales. Overly complex layouts may lose detail when shrunk down for nail decals or pen wraps.
Contrast is another critical factor. Test how the graphics look on both white and dark backgrounds. If the SVG design relies on fine internal details, it may disappear on a black t-shirt unless a shadow or outline layer is added. Sellers should also be wary of using text-heavy templates in crowded thumbnails; negative space is essential for click-through potential. Finally, always verify PNG transparency. Nothing generates negative reviews faster than a customer receiving a file with a white box background when they expected a transparent overlay for their own designs.
Seller Checklist for Quality Assurance and Licensing
Before publishing any product derived from or including the Goodness of God Svg, Christian Svg, Bible assets, run through this practical quality assurance checklist. This process minimizes returns and protects your shop reputation:
- Verify Commercial License: Confirm the specific terms allow for the intended use, whether that is selling physical products, digital templates, or modified designs. Never assume rights based on category alone.
- Test Cut and Print: Physically cut at least three different styles from the bundle on your machine. Print a test page to check color accuracy and resolution at actual size.
- Font Pairing Validation: If adding additional text, test pairings with serif, sans serif, and handwritten fonts to ensure the original design’s integrity is maintained.
- File Organization: Ensure the downloadable zip is organized logically. Customers appreciate folders separated by format (SVG vs. PNG) or theme.
- Mockup Diversity: Create previews showing the design on light fabrics, dark fabrics, paper products, and digital screens to cover all potential use cases.
- Keyword Alignment: Ensure your tags accurately reflect the specific verses or sentiments included, rather than just generic terms.
